hideous_kinky wrote: »Thanks for such quick replies! I had been thinking of a Fuji as I've some good reviews. Is it worth spending a little extra to get the J10 rather than the A850?
The A850 if a starter camera from Fuji( still a good camera). If you want to spend a bit more the J10 is a step up from the A850. The J10 has it's own battery & uses 2 types of memory card, not to be too technical but the iso also goes up to 1600 so it has a better spec than the A850. It is also a bit slimmer, so uses up less room in your bag.
I have an F10 with an internal battery, when fully charged it takes about 500 shots, so plenty of power if you take it on holiday.
